Yemen facing highest burden' of global cholera outbreak, WHO warns
Briefly

Yemen reported 249,900 suspected cases of cholera and 861 deaths this year, representing 35% of the global burden, highlighting a severe health crisis.
The increase in cholera cases this year is primarily due to updated data from Yemen, with 37% more cases and 27% more deaths reported in November.
Humanitarian efforts in Yemen are constrained by a $20 million funding gap, forcing the WHO to close treatment centres, which severely limits disease management.
Immediate actions are necessary, including enhanced water, sanitation, hygiene initiatives, and improved access to cholera vaccinations, to tackle the urgent cholera situation in Yemen.
